Common questions about PREMIERONE CREDIT UNION
What does the Chief Executive Officer of PREMIERONE CREDIT UNION earn?
In 2024, the Chief Executive Officer of PREMIERONE CREDIT UNION received $677,131 in total compensation. This pay is in the top 10% for Chief Executive Officer roles among nonprofits nationwide, across all sectors: at least 9 in 10 comparable filings report less. Based on IRS Form 990 data.
How does Chief Executive Officer pay at PREMIERONE CREDIT UNION compare with similar nonprofits?
Compared with the same role at nonprofits nationwide, across all sectors, the 2024 pay of the Chief Executive Officer at PREMIERONE CREDIT UNION falls in the top 10%.
What are PREMIERONE CREDIT UNION's revenue and expenses?
In 2024, PREMIERONE CREDIT UNION reported $36.2M in total revenue and $30.9M in total expenses on its IRS Form 990.
